Translational Neuroscience Optimization of GlyT1 Inhibitor
This is a Phase II, randomized, double-blind, placebo-controlled, cross-over POC study of stable patients with Schizophrenia or Schizoaffective disorder. The primary objective of this study is to test the efficacy of treatment with one of two does of a glycine transporter inhibitor (GlyT1I) combined with cognitive remediation to enhavce cognitive function. Subjects will be randomized to one of two doses of the glycine transporter inhibitor (GlyT1I) and placebo twice daily in addition to their antipsychotic medication for 2 treatment periods, each lasting a minimum of 5 weeks. Treatment periods will be separated by a washout period lasting approximately 3 weeks.

Change in Measurement and Treatment Research to Improve Cognition in Schizophrenia (MATRICS) Consensus Cognitive Battery (MCCB)
Time frame: Change from baseline in cognitive measures at approximately 5 weeks. Mean scores were calculated per time point for each arm.
To test the efficacy of PF-03463275 on cognitive test performance specifically, the MCCB composite score was used. The MCCB consists of 10 tests and provides standard scores and percentiles for each of seven cognitive domains and an overall composite score. Domains assessed include: speed of processing, attention/vigilance, working memory (verbal and visual), verbal learning, visual learning, reasoning and problem solving, and social cognition. The MCCB overall composite score is presented as a T-score. The range of T-scores is between 0 to 100 with a mean of 50 and standard deviation of 10. Higher scores indicate better overall cognitive functioning.
